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software is essential for any successful tech sales team. It helps you keep track of customer interactions, streamline processes, and successfully manage relationships with clients. However, with all the features and capabilities of a CRM, it can be difficult to maximize your usage of it. To help you get the most out of your CRM, here are some tips and tricks to help you revolutionise your tech sales team.
Tip 1: Invest in a User-Friendly CRM
The first step to making the most of your CRM is to invest in a user-friendly platform. Look for a CRM with an intuitive design and an easy-to-navigate interface. This will make it easier for your team to access and use the platform, which will help them to be more productive and efficient.
Tip 2: Automate Your Processes
Take advantage of the automation features that come with your CRM. Automation can help streamline processes, save time, and ensure that tasks are completed accurately and on time. For instance, you can set up automated email reminders to customers or set up automated workflows for onboarding new customers.
Tip 3: Implement a Process for Data Entry
In order for your CRM to be effective, it’s important that your team consistently inputs data. To ensure this happens, consider implementing a process for data entry. You can also use third-party integration tools to help streamline the data entry process and make it easier for your team to keep track of customer data.
Tip 4: Train Your Team
Your team should be trained on how to use your CRM in order to get the most out of it. Make sure they understand the basics of the platform and how to use it efficiently. You can also provide regular refresher courses to ensure your team remains up-to-date on the latest features and best practices.
Tip 5: Customise Your CRM
Take advantage of the customisation features that come with your CRM. You can customise features to make it easier for your team to work with the platform and tailor it to your specific needs. This can help optimise your usage of the CRM and make it easier for your team to access the information they need.
Tip 6: Utilise Reporting Features
Your CRM should also come with reporting features that can be used to measure success and track progress. This includes features such as analytics, which can show you how your team is performing and give you insights into which strategies are working and which are not.
Tip 7: Monitor Your Data
It’s important to regularly monitor your data to ensure accuracy and completeness. This can help you identify any gaps or errors in your data entry processes, as well as any discrepancies in customer information.
Tip 8: Prioritise Security
Security is a major concern when it comes to CRMs, as they contain a wealth of customer and financial data. Make sure your CRM has the necessary security protocols in place, such as encryption and two-factor authentication, to protect your customer data from potential risks.
Tip 9: Integrate with Other Platforms
You can also use your CRM to integrate with other platforms, such as email and social media, to get a better understanding of customer behaviour and preferences. This can help you tailor your marketing and sales processes to better meet customer needs.
Tip 10: Use Data Visualization Tools
Data visualization tools are a great way to keep track of your customer data and track trends. These tools can help you easily identify key insights and make better decisions based on your data.
By following these tips, you can maximize your usage of the CRM to help revolutionise your tech sales team. By investing in a user-friendly platform, automating processes, and customising your CRM to meet your needs, you can ensure that your team is optimally utilizing the platform.
